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Colby College to Boston is to drive which costs $30 - $50 and takes 3h 8m.
The fastest way to get from Colby College to Boston is to fly which takes 1h 52m and costs $150 - $200.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Colby College Museum of Art and arriving at Boston, MA - South Station station. Services depart twice a week, and operate Friday and Sunday. The journey takes approximately 3h 45m.
The distance between Colby College and Boston is 170 miles. The road distance is 180.4 miles.
The best way to get from Colby College to Boston without a car is to bus which takes 3h 48m and costs $40 - $55.
It takes approximately 1h 52m to get from Colby College to Boston, including transfers.
Colby College to Boston bus services, operated by Concord Coach Lines, depart from Colby College Museum of Art station.
The best way to get from Colby College to Boston is to fly which takes 1h 52m and costs $150 - $200.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s $40 - $55 and takes 3h 48m.
Colby College to Boston bus services, operated by Concord Coach Lines, arrive at Boston, MA - South Station.
Yes, the driving distance between Colby College to Boston is 180 miles. It takes approximately 3h 8m to drive from Colby College to Boston.
What companies run services between Colby College, ME, USA and Boston, MA, USA?
Cape Air flies from Augusta State Airport (AUG) to Boston Logan Airport (BOS) 3 times a day. Alternatively, Concord Coach Lines operates a bus from Colby College Museum of Art to Boston, MA - South Station twice a week. Tickets cost $40–55 and the journey takes 3h 45m.
